Cryptography terms
• Cryptology is the science of secret codes
• Cryptography deals with systems for translating
data into codes that are meaningless to anyone
who does not possess the system for recovering
the initial data.
• Cryptanalysis are the techniques for recovering
encrypted data
• Cipher is an algorithm for performing encryption
or decryption

Cryptographic Techniques
They are three classes of techniques for enciphering
plaintext:
• Substitution ciphers
• Transposition ciphers.
• Product ciphers

Choosing a Cipher System
• A cipher system has two components: algorithm
and the key
• Five desirable properties of a cipher system:
• High Work Factor
• Small key
• Simplicity
• Low error propagation
• Little expansion of message size.
